Mortgage applications rise 1.1% as rates stabilize

Mortgage shoppers submitted 1.1% more applications for the week ending May 9 than they did at the end of April, according to the Mortgage Bankers Association. The trade group’s Refinance Index also fell 0.4%, as volatility driven by economic uncertainty appears to fade.  Consumers watched rates for all but 15-year fixed-rate and jumbo mortgages rise, […]
